How to use the fire safety rope
How to use a fire safety rope? Today I'm going to share with you some useful tips on using a fire safety rope.
The fire safety rope is made of high-strength fire retardant fibers that provide excellent strength and resistance to breakage. The outer layer is woven with chemical fiber material to ensure the rope is strong and durable, and not easy to fall off or lint. In addition, the surface of the fire safety rope is added with flame retardant so that it is not easy to burn in high temperature condition and possesses the characteristics of fire resistance and high temperature resistance.
Fire safety rope is an important tool in fire escape, especially widely used in high-rise buildings. When a fire occurs, if we cannot find other escape routes, we can use the fire safety rope to escape quickly through the window.
Let's compare the difference between fire safety ropes and climbing ropes:
- Uses: Fire safety rope is mainly used for fire escape, which can slowly land trapped people from high-rise buildings to the ground. And mountaineering rope is used for self-protection, auxiliary knot protection, crossing rivers and bridges, material transportation and other mountaineering activities.
- Performance: The obvious difference is that the two have different performance in use. Fire safety ropes are static ropes with no elasticity. While the climbing rope belongs to the dynamic rope, has a certain degree of elasticity, can absorb the impact of the fall, to protect the body safety. When falling from a height of more than 3 meters, the fire safety rope will cause damage to the body.
Another difference is that fire safety ropes are resistant to burns and high temperatures, whereas mountaineering ropes are not. Fire safety ropes are a combination of a jogger and a harness that can safely, easily and quickly lower an escapee to the ground and can be reused many times.
Since fire safety ropes are usually used for high-rise escapes and pose a risk to the escapee, it is important to learn the proper way to use them. Below are the steps for using a fire safety rope:
- Step 1: Start by finding a sturdy fixture and tie the rope in a secure knot to the fixture, such as a post, railing or window frame. It is critical to make sure that the fixture is secure and reliable.
- Step 2: Fasten the harness and attach it to the figure of 8 loop and the lanyard. Thread the rope cord through the large loop and around the small loop, open the hook door of the main lock and hook the small loop of the 8-ring into the main lock.
- Step 3: After confirming that all connections are secure, throw the safety rope out the window and descend along the wall.
If you live below the third floor, when there are no fire safety ropes available, you may want to consider using items around you to knot into a makeshift rope for escape. However, please try to choose stronger items such as bed sheets rather than clothing. If time permits, it is a good idea to wet the sheets to increase the carrying capacity of the rope.
